Webinar Overview

In today’s hybrid work world, IT teams are increasingly responsible for assuring seamless and secure access to business-critical applications across a diverse network environment. SD-WAN and SASE have become two popular options to meet this demand, providing greater flexibility and scalability to IT organizations looking to support a growing number of distributed workers, distributed applications, and distributed systems.

Yet, understanding users’ end-to-end digital experience has long been a challenge for networking and IT teams. Internet blind spots and tunnels created by VPNs and SD-WANs combine to create a perfect storm, limiting visibility and hamstringing troubleshooting efforts. In order to effectively assure digital experiences across the enterprise, you need end-to-end command of your new digital environment.

Register for this webinar to learn best practices for optimizing your SD-WAN and SASE to enable seamless, secure digital experiences. In this session, we will look at:

  • Availability at branch offices and how to help ensure performance for mission-critical applications
  • Measuring end-user experience, regardless of location, to the apps employees need
  • Monitoring your hybrid infrastructure, including your security edge providers

You will also see a demo with recommendations on configuration settings to move from a reactive to a proactive approach.
